LEN launches X-ray
JAKARTA (JP): PT LEN Industri, a state owned company overseen
by the Management Board of Strategic Industries, has launched new
X-ray instruments in cooperation with Heimman of Germany, and PT
Metro Eka Pelita Niaga.
Minister of Transportation Haryanto Dhanutirto said on Friday
that the instruments, which were assembled in Bandung of West
Java, were used for security checks at ports and airports.
The company's commercial director, Dedi Hidayat Rivai, said
LEN Industri had produced eight instruments, called X-Ray LEN
Heimman, for its initial production.
Dedi explained that at the first stage, LEN Industri assembled
components supplied by Heimman and would increase the local
contents of its future production. (04)
